One Good Thing: Yale Honors Girl Who Neighbor Called Police On for Spraying Spotted Lanternflies
Nine-year-old Bobbi Wilson of New Jersey has caught the attention of the Yale School of Public Health for her commitment to exterminating spotted lanternflies. Last year, while spraying the bugs in her neighborhood, a neighbor called police on the little girl.
